Also if someone could help me... is there an easy way to change a material bgsm that is "attached" to a shape of a nif file using Nifscope ? Specifically, I was hopping to use the materials of the new microbikinis with some of the bikinis in other outfits (all 2pac's), since I noticed they are the same mesh. thanks in advance
BringtheNoise Posted January 20, 2016 Posted January 20, 2016 My new favourite outfit! Thanks for your work! Also if someone could help me... is there an easy way to change a material bgsm that is "attached" to a shape of a nif file using Nifscope ? Specifically, I was hopping to use the materials of the new microbikinis with some of the bikinis in other outfits (all 2pac's), since I noticed they are the same mesh. thanks in advance Just open the Reference nif in nifscope. In the Block List (default to being on the left side) click on the bikini mesh to show the sub nodes. Click on the "BSLightingShaderProperty" for the mesh it should list "Materials\something\ISomethingelse\filename.BGSM" In the Block Details (Down at the bottom) right click on the value for the "Name" line a box will open up with the patch... right click and copy (then hit cancel to make sure you didn't mess anything up). Now paste that into Notepad (just incase you copy something else you've have it in an open notepad window). Close the nif you got the path from (do not save as this was the reference nif). Now go find the nif's you want to change the BGSM path in. Do the above steps but this time you are going to edit the Value in the Block details and save it with the changes. Note: The BGSM will probably override the texture path that your nif pointed to. Which means your going to end up with the same textures as the reference nif cause you are using the same bgsm file. Now if you want to have the similar settings as the bgsm file but point to a texture you want. You can open the bgsm's with Cell's Material Editor Program ( http://www.nexusmods.com/fallout4/mods/3635/? ). For this you will want to open 2 instances of the Material editor. In one you open the bgsm that your nif points to and in the other you open 2pac's bgsm. In 2pac's change the texture path to what you want your nif to point to (copy this from your bgsm and paste into 2pac's). This will retain 2pac's settings for gloss, and other stuff while pointing to your textures....and "save file as" and replace your bgsm (not 2pac's). This way you get all the settings that are in 2pac's but with your textures...
